The Role at a glance:

We are looking for a Director of Business Development to drive new business growth within Elior’s Collegiate Dining segment. This is a highly field-based role focused on identifying, developing, and winning new client partnerships. This is a true hunter sales role. Success requires someone who is comfortable building their own pipeline from the ground up. You will be expected to proactively identify target organizations, make connections, cold call, network, prospect, and create opportunities.

You will own opportunities throughout a consultative sales cycle—and develop relationships with senior decision-makers, including university and college presidents, executives, and operational leaders. This role requires significant travel, typically 60–75%, to meet prospects, attend industry events, develop relationships, and pursue new business opportunities.

The Director of Business Development reports to the Senior Vice President, Growth.

About Elior Collegiate:

Elior Collegiate Dining is rewriting the rules of campus dining, serving up bold flavors, fresh ideas, and high-impact experiences that fuel student life. We partner with forward-thinking colleges and universities to create vibrant, customized dining programs that spark connection, celebrate culture, and make food a defining part of the college journey.
